Delicious original Malasadas donuts. I highly suggest eating them as soon as you buy them to eat them warm and fresh. They have filled chocolate, custard or coconut but the best of the best is always the original. Stop for a cup of coffee before you get here to enjoy your Malasadas more because then only sell water here.
